AI startup RunPod raises $20M in seed funding to help developers deploy custom full-stack AI applications

The artificial intelligence (AI) wave that started in 2022 with the launch of chatGPT is showing no signs of slowing down, with investors increasingly betting big on innovative generative AI startups. The latest is RunPod, an AI startup that provides a launchpad to assist developers in deploying custom full-stack AI applications.

Today, RunPod announced it has raised $20 million in seed funding co-led by Intel Capital and Dell Technologies Capital with participation from Julien Chaummond, Nat Friedman, and Adam Lewis. Alongside the funding, RunPod also announced that Mark Rostick, Vice President and Senior Managing Director at Intel Capital, will join its board of directors.

RunPod operates as a globally distributed GPU cloud computing service, catering to the needs of developers in training, deploying, and scaling AI models. Leveraging RunPod’s core offerings—GPU Cloud and Serverless—developers can effortlessly launch on-demand GPU instances and establish autoscaling API endpoints for AI model inference in production environments.
